Any  suggestions on what
to do with the switch?



Use the switch to operate a relay (DPDT).  The relay can handle a  larger 
load then the switch.  Plus, the relay is much easier to  replace or trouble 
shoot in the event of future service.   I have an  original military grip w/cooley 
hat.  It would be tough to find a  replacement switch for that, so I elected 
to use relays to carry both the roll  and pitch loads.  Has worked fine for 11 
years.
